You might be able to add just 0 to the value for the poison zombies. As for the weapon_scripted, all you need to do it add the name of the script and nothing else. I have coded it so if the script doesnt exist in that folder by that name the weapon will remove itself and spit out a console error.

Example, all you need to type is custom_deagle for the deagle weapon.
